Short General Description of Pepcid

Pepcid is a medication that belongs to a class of drugs known as histamine-2 blockers. It works by reducing the amount of acid produced in the stomach, which helps to alleviate symptoms of conditions such as heartburn, g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), and stomach ulcers.

What is heartburn?

Heartburn, also known as acid indigestion, is a burning sensation in the chest that occurs when stomach acid flows back up into the esophagus. This happens when the lower esophageal sphincter (LES), a muscle that acts as a valve between the stomach and esophagus, weakens or relaxes improperly.

Understanding GERD

GERD is a chronic condition in which the stomach acid and sometimes bile flows back into the esophagus, causing irritation and inflammation. It can lead to a variety of symptoms, including heartburn, chest pain, difficulty swallowing, and coughing.

How does Pepcid work?

Pepcid is classified as a histamine-2 blocker, also known as an H2 antagonist. It works by blocking the action of histamine, a natural substance in the body that stimulates the release of stomach acid. By reducing the acid production, Pepcid helps alleviate the symptoms of heartburn and GERD.

How Does Pepcid Work?

Pepcid works by blocking the action of histamine, a naturally occurring substance in the body that stimulates the production of stomach acid. By inhibiting histamine-2 receptors, Pepcid reduces the production of acid, providing relief from heartburn and associated symptoms. It helps in healing the esophagus and preventing further damage caused by acid reflux.

4. Common Side Effects of Pepcid

Pepcid, like any medication, may cause certain side effects in some individuals. It is important to be aware of these potential side effects, although they may not occur in everyone who takes the medication. If you experience any severe or persistent side effects, it is crucial to consult your healthcare provider.

4.1. Common side effects:

  • Headache: A common side effect of Pepcid is a mild headache. This can usually be relieved with over-the-counter pain medications.
  • Dizziness: Some individuals may experience episodes of dizziness while taking Pepcid. It is advisable to avoid driving or operating machinery if you feel dizzy.
  • Nausea or upset stomach: It is possible to experience mild gastrointestinal discomfort, such as nausea or an upset stomach, when taking Pepcid. Ensuring that you take the medication with food may help alleviate these symptoms.
  • Constipation or diarrhea: Pepcid can occasionally cause changes in bowel habits. Constipation or diarrhea may occur, but these symptoms are usually temporary and resolve on their own.

4.2. Rare but serious side effects:

While rare, there are some severe side effects associated with Pepcid. If you experience any of the following symptoms, seek medical attention immediately:

  • Allergic reaction: Some individuals may have a severe allergic reaction to Pepcid, which can lead to swelling of the face, tongue, or throat, difficulty breathing, or a rash. If you experience any of these symptoms, call emergency services immediately.
  • Chest pain: In rare cases, Pepcid can cause chest pain or tightness. It is essential to seek immediate medical attention if you experience these symptoms.
  • Irregular heartbeat: Although uncommon, Pepcid may occasionally cause an irregular heartbeat. If you notice any changes in your heart rhythm, inform your healthcare provider or go to the nearest emergency room.

7. Pepcid Dosage and Administration

When it comes to taking Pepcid, it’s crucial to follow the appropriate dosage and administration guidelines recommended by healthcare professionals. The correct dosage may vary depending on the specific condition being treated and individual patient factors. Therefore, it’s always advisable to consult a healthcare provider before initiating any medication, including Pepcid.

7.1 Dosage for Adults

For the treatment of heartburn and acid indigestion, the recommended dosage of Pepcid for adults is usually 10 mg to 20 mg, taken orally, once or twice a day. The duration of treatment may vary, but it is generally for a short-term period of up to 2 weeks.

In the case of GERD, the dosage may be slightly higher, typically ranging from 20 mg to 40 mg, taken orally, once or twice daily. The duration of treatment for GERD can be longer and may extend up to 12 weeks.

7.2 Dosage for Pediatric Use

Pepcid may also be prescribed for children above the age of 1 year old. The dosage for pediatric patients is determined based on the child’s weight, medical condition, and other factors. The healthcare provider will determine the appropriate dosage for the child.

7.3 Administration Guidelines

Pepcid tablets should be taken orally, with or without food. It’s recommended to swallow the tablets whole with a glass of water. Crushing, chewing, or breaking the tablets should be avoided unless specifically instructed by a healthcare professional.

If a patient has difficulty swallowing tablets, an alternative form of Pepcid, such as an oral suspension, may be available. It’s important to follow the specific instructions provided by the healthcare provider or read the medication label carefully regarding the administration of alternative forms.

7.4 Special Considerations

It’s crucial to adhere to the prescribed dosage and schedule of Pepcid. Skipping doses or exceeding the recommended dosage can increase the risk of side effects and may not provide the desired therapeutic effect.

Any changes in dosage or treatment duration should be discussed with a healthcare provider. Additionally, if symptoms persist or worsen despite taking Pepcid as prescribed, medical advice should be sought.
